11/10/2023 0 Comments Gameboy dmg cpu internals![]() This type of chip is called ‘System On Chip’ (SoC) and the one found on the GameBoy is referred to as DMG-CPU or Sharp LR35902. Instead of placing many off-the-shelf chips on the motherboard, Nintendo opted for a single chip to house (and hide) most of the components, including the CPU. The Game Boy can be imagined as a portable version of the NES with limited power, but you’ll see that it included very interesting new functionality.
